you have any advice for young artists or teenagers who want to pursue music as a career but also feel pressure to attain a college degree? It’s definitely something that you’ve got to be all in for. And that doesn’t mean that you can’t go to college and get your degree and still be all in and writing songs and singing. I went to college while I was still on tour, and I didn’t quite make it to my degree - but I would like to finish it up one day because I think that’s important. But yeah, if you really want to make it, especially in country music, Nashville is the place you gotta be and just getting in there and networking and meeting people. And you’ll really learn that everybody is really friendly, and it’s like 12 a big family down there. And if they see that you’re taking it seriously, and that you’re really passionate about it, that you’ve got the chops people will really embrace you up there. So it’s a fun business.
